Betty J Andersen

March 2, 1927 — March 28, 2012

Betty Jean Andersen, 85, of Kingsley, died Wednesday, March 28, 2012, at Mercy Medical Center in Sioux City, Iowa.Visitation will be Friday, March 30, from 4:00-7:00 p.m., with the family present from 5:00-7:00 p.m., and prayer service at 7:00 p.m. at the Kingsley United Methodist Church. Funeral services will be Saturday, March 31, at 11:00 a.m., at the Kingsley United Methodist Church, followed by lunch at the church, with burial following at the Correctionville Cemetery, under the direction of the Rohde Funeral Home. Betty Jean Andersen was born March 3, 1927 in Correctionville, Iowa to Guy and Dora (Clark) Keller. She graduated from Correctionville High School in 1946. She married Harley "Whitey" Andersen on November 13, 1947 in Correctionville, Iowa. In 1949, they bought the Wausa Gazette in Wausa, Nebraska. They sold it in 1955. In 1956, they bought the Kingsley News-Times and, after owning and operating the newspaper for 20 years, they retired in February of 1976.Betty was a member of the Kingsley United Methodist Church. She was a member and past Worthy Matron of the Garfield Chapter of the Order of Eastern Star. She was also co-leader of Campfire Girls when her girls were small. She was also a member of the Red Hat Society in Spirit Lake. Betty loved to cook and entertain, and she always had a fresh-baked pie, cake or cookies on hand for anyone who stopped by for a chat.Survivors include her three daughters, Karen and her husband, Tom Bennett, of Denver, Colorado, Carol and her husband John Schwartz, of Hospers, Iowa, and Susan Steffen of Moville, Iowa; seven grandchildren, Tyler Martinson, Timothy and Rebecca Bennett, Kelly Andersen and Kevin Kirchner, and Cory and Eric Steffen; three great grandchildren, Ravyn Andersen and Jaycee and Gavin Kirchner.She was preceded in death by her parents, her husband, Whitey Andersen, her sister, Phyllis Kroeger and her brother, Donald Keller.
